Folk legend Beans on Toast is coming to town.

A travelling troubadour for the ages, Beans is an entertainer, singer, songwriter, storyteller – and a master of his art.

His songs celebrate the human spirit, from the beauty of the everyday to the dilemmas of the modern world. They connect with listeners in a unique and powerful way, earning him a devoted following across the globe and making him a staple on the UK festival circuit.

This winter, he’ll be visiting towns and cities often overlooked on the UK touring map – bringing his legendary, unpredictable, and always uplifting live show to a venue near you. Expect crowd favourites from years gone by, alongside fresh new songs about the state of the world.
